Transaction 101f84fe629ae34dddb7f4e56e75e712dfcfd0e3293392ad56538e32f99fca5e

1 Input
2 Outputs
  • 101f84fe629ae34dddb7f4e56e75e712dfcfd0e3293392ad56538e32f99fca5e:0
  • value  2099668
    address  2MvMJhnBsTFQooA7yMYf9o1on8gUsKYp9yx
  • 101f84fe629ae34dddb7f4e56e75e712dfcfd0e3293392ad56538e32f99fca5e:1
  • value  1000000
    address  2NAMYsb4V1XtPPxJT4v4w29mpT6uVRWpGJq